Throughout the physical examination, your doctor might examine your muscle strength and reflexes (sciatica home treatment). For example, you might be asked to walk on your toes or heels, rise from a squatting position and, while pushing your back, lift your legs one at a time. Discomfort that results from sciatica will normally intensify throughout these activities.

If your discomfort doesn't improve with self-care measures, your physician might suggest a few of the following treatments. The kinds of drugs that might be prescribed for sciatica discomfort include: Anti-inflammatories Muscle relaxants Narcotics Tricyclic antidepressants Anti-seizure medications When your sharp pain enhances, your medical professional or a physical therapist can design a rehabilitation program to help you avoid future injuries (best treatment for sciatica).
In some cases, your physician might recommend injection of a corticosteroid medication into the location around the involved nerve root. Corticosteroids assist reduce discomfort by suppressing swelling around the inflamed nerve. The impacts generally wear off in a few months. sciatica treatment exercises. The number of steroid injections you can get is restricted because the danger of severe negative effects increases when the injections happen too regularly.
Surgeons can get rid of the bone spur or the portion of the herniated disk that's continuing the pinched nerve. For the majority of individuals, sciatica reacts to self-care measures. treatment for sciatica pain in leg. Although resting for a day approximately might supply some relief, prolonged inactivity will make your indications and symptoms even worse. Other self-care treatments that may assist consist of: Initially, you might get relief from an ice bag put on the uncomfortable location for up to 20 minutes a number of times a day.
After 2 to 3 days, use heat to the locations that hurt. Use hot packs, a heat light or a heating pad on the most affordable setting. If you continue to have pain, try alternating warm and cold packs. Extending workouts for your low back can assist you feel better and might help eliminate nerve root compression - treatment of sciatica.
Pain reducers such as ibuprofen (Advil, Motrin IB, others) and naproxen salt (Aleve) are in some cases valuable for sciatica. Alternative treatments frequently used for low neck and back pain include: In acupuncture, the specialist inserts hair-thin needles into your skin at specific points on your body - sciatica pain treatment. Some studies have recommended that acupuncture can assist pain in the back, while others have found no benefit (what is the best treatment for sciatica?).
Spine adjustment (control) is one form of treatment chiropractics physician utilize to treat restricted spine mobility (chiropractic treatment for sciatica). The objective is to bring back spinal movement and, as a result, enhance function and reduce pain (sciatica natural treatment). Back adjustment seems as effective and safe as basic treatments for low neck and back pain, however may not be appropriate for radiating pain.

Sciatica is pain that begins in your lower back and shoots down through your legs and sometimes into your feet. It takes place when something in your body-- possibly a herniated disk or bone spur compresses your sciatic nerve. Some people experience sharp, extreme discomfort, and others get tingling, weakness, and numbness in their legs.
The majority of people with sciatica don't end up needing surgical treatment, and about half improve within 6 weeks with only rest and medication - treatment for sciatica pain in leg. So what do you need to do after your physician makes a diagnosis of sciatica?Most people with sciatica improve in a couple of weeks with at-home solutions. If your pain is fairly mild and it isn't stopping you from doing your day-to-day activities, your physician will initially suggest attempting some combination of these fundamental solutions.

Many people think that alternative therapies like yoga, massage, biofeedback, and acupuncture aid with sciatica. Yourfirst option should be over-the-counter discomfort reducers. Acetaminophen and NSAIDs( n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s) like aspirin, ibuprofen, and naproxen are really valuable, but you should not use them for extended periods without speaking withyour medical professional. Tricyclic antidepressants such as amitriptyline( Elavil )and anti- seizure medications sometimes work, too.
Steroid injections straight into the inflamed nerve can also offer you with minimal relief. Whenall else stops working, surgical treatment is the last hope for about 5% to 10% of individuals with sciatica. There are multiple versions of this stretch. sciatica treatment. The first is a starting variation referred to as the reclining pigeon position. If you're simply starting your treatment, you should attempt the reclining position initially. While on your back, bring your ideal leg up to an ideal angle. Clasp both hands behind the thigh, locking your fingers. Hold the position for a minute.
This assists stretch the small piriformis muscle, which in some cases becomes swollen and presses against the sciatic nerve, triggering discomfort. Do the very same exercise with the other leg. Once you can do the reclining variation without pain, work with your physical therapist on the sitting and forward variations of pigeon posture.
